Solar Modules Degrading Faster Than Expected
June 10th, 2021Via: PV Tech:
Solar asset underperformance continues to worsen, with projects “chronically underperforming” P99 estimates and modules degrading faster than previously anticipated, risk management firm kWh Analytics has found.

Perhaps the most notable finding from the report, which builds on a finding from last year’s edition, is that operational solar assets are continuing to experience higher than expected rates of degradation, with annual degradation in the field observed at around 1%.
It cites recent research conducted by both National Renewable Energy Laboratory (NREL) and Lawrence Berkeley National Laboratory, as well as kWh Analytics, as demonstrating that assumptions made in 2016 – that annually solar modules would degrade by around 0.5%, is outdated and underestimates annual degradation by as much as 0.5%.
kWh Analytics’ most recent figures place the median annual degradation for residential solar systems as 1.09% and non-residential systems at 0.8%. The report states that over a 20-year asset life, project degradation could therefore be underestimated by as much as 14%, resulting in severally overestimated performance and revenue forecasts produced within a P50 model.
